If you’re a big fan of rice but have to moderate your intake due to diet restrictions—don’t worry—you’ll still be able to enjoy pulao (pilaf), curries and other “ricey” dishes, just using quinoa instead!

Quinoa is one of the healthiest seeds you can find and is an excellent choice for replacing rice, being a rich source of protein and containing less carbohydrates in comparison.

The taste of quinoa is also prettyneutral, which allows you to use it in almost every dish you can think of.

You can use steamed quinoa with your Thai or Indian Curries, and if you’re thinking about different combinations, have a look at the quinoa recipes in our best vegan recipescollection for more inspiration and ideas!

Since quinoa is in vogue for its nutritional value, we prepared this roundup featuring some of the best vegan quinoa recipes.

Here, we show you exactly how versatile it can be.

Simple Kale Quinoa

50 Vegan Quinoa Recipes for Your Next Protein Boost (11)

There may be days when you simplydon’t feel like cooking a huge meal and that’s okay, everyone deserves a breather from the kitchen. You can still eat healthily rather than something greasy, though.

This recipe uses minimal ingredients and is cooked in a jiffy. Just toast quinoa in almond butter, add vegetable broth to boil it with a few seasonings. Then include chopped kale and you’re set to eat!

You can work with what you have such as use carrots, peas or mushrooms.

Green Pea Quinoa

50 Vegan Quinoa Recipes for Your Next Protein Boost (34)

This recipe is verysimple and the perfect accompaniment for your Thai or Indian curries.

Quinoa and frozen peas are cooked with just salt and pepper for seasonings. What you get is a fluffy plate of pulao (pilaf) that is light on your stomach and gives you the same satisfaction as eating rice!

Just make sure towash off the outer layer of quinoa as they have a slightly bitter taste. Perfect recipe!
